So many Canadians wait all year long for the summer and it’s no secret why! From longer days to warmer weather, to the amazing seasonal activities available, there’s no wonder why summer is so many Canadian’s favourite time of year! While enjoying your summer is very important, what’s more important is keeping yourself and your loved ones safe while you’re out having fun in the sun. For the best summer possible, keep in mind these simple summer safety tips! 

Drive Carefully 
Many people are on the road during the summer, whether it’s to go on a vacation or road trip, driving to the beach, or even just going on a long summer day drive through the city. While driving in the summer is a lot of fun, it’s important to realize that more car accidents happen in the summer than at any other time of the year. So, be mindful while driving this summer to uphold your safety. This means making sure your car is in good shape, being mindful of other drivers on the road, and driving at a safe speed. 

Practice Fire Safety 
Summer evenings are the perfect time for a campout, a barbecue, or a bonfire. It can be super fun to enjoy a good old-fashioned cookout! However, when you’re around the fire this summer, make sure you treat it as a safety concern because while it is fun, it can still cause a significant risk to your safety. Make sure you practice fire safety by keeping a good distance, keeping children and pets away, and not setting up your fire where there are trees or other flammable materials closeby. 

Be Careful In The Water 
Whether you’re in the pool, the lake, or the ocean, swimming and other aquatic activities are a great way to keep cool and have fun in the summer. Enjoy your time in the water this summer, but also make sure to uphold a sense of safety through good practices. Never swim without a buddy, keep a close eye on pets and children, and if you choose to participate in activities like boating, tubing, or other water fun, make sure you’re being mindful and careful every moment you’re in the water.
